Drain Cleaning in De Kalb, MS
A clogged kitchen drain in De Kalb is one of those problems that starts as a minor annoyance and escalates steadily โ water draining slowly, then standing in the sink, then not moving at all. Grease and food particles accumulate on pipe walls gradually, narrowing the drain line over years until a tipping point is reached. Store-bought drain chemicals break down the soft organic matter in the clog temporarily but don't address the buildup on the walls โ which is why the drain clogs again within weeks. We clear kitchen drains throughout Kemper County and can assess whether buildup has progressed to the point where a line cleaning rather than a spot clearing is the more durable solution.

Water Heater Services in De Kalb
The temperature and pressure relief valve on a De Kalb home's water heater is not a nuisance โ it's the safety device that prevents tank explosion when temperature or pressure exceeds rated limits. A TPR valve that drips or discharges is signaling that something in the system is exceeding safe parameters. A TPR valve that has never been tested may be stuck or corroded and unable to open when needed. We test TPR valves during every water heater service visit in Kemper County and replace them when they show signs of failure or have never been tested since installation.
Signs your De Kalb water heater needs attention: water that no longer gets fully hot, rust or discoloration in hot water, popping or rumbling during heating cycles, water pooling around the base, or a unit that's more than 10 years old. Sewer Line Services in De Kalb, Mississippi
A De Kalb sewer line that's backing up, running slowly, or showing surface signs of failure needs a camera inspection before any work begins. We send a waterproof HD camera through the line and provide a recording of what we find. Kemper County homes built before 1980 commonly have clay tile laterals where joint gaps have widened over decades โ creating entry points for tree roots. Where those gaps are localized, trenchless pipe lining can seal them without excavation. Where damage is extensive, pipe bursting or open-trench replacement is the appropriate solution.

Preventive Plumbing Tips for De Kalb Homeowners
A water heater maintenance schedule for a De Kalb home depends on age and local water quality. Under 5 years old in soft water: flush annually, inspect T&P valve annually. 5โ10 years old in moderate water: flush annually, inspect anode rod every 3 years. Over 10 years old in any water condition: annual professional assessment โ units at this age are past rated service life and should be evaluated for replacement planning.
